The Convenience of the UH-60



The UH-60 helicopter shows amazing versatility in its array of capacities and objectives. Created mainly as a medium-lift energy helicopter for the United state Military, the UH-60 has confirmed itself to be adaptable to a vast variety of jobs.


In terms of its operational abilities, the UH-60 is outfitted with innovative avionics and navigation systems, allowing it to carry out objectives in day, evening, and adverse weather condition problems. It has a series of over 320 maritime miles and a maximum speed of around 185 knots. With its powerful engines, the UH-60 can run at high elevations and in humid and warm atmospheres, making it ideal for a vast array of geographical locations.


Moreover, the UH-60 is outfitted with various protective systems, including sophisticated radar cautioning receivers, missile caution systems, and countermeasures dispensing systems, ensuring its survivability in hostile environments. Its versatility expands beyond conventional military operations, as it can likewise be changed for search and rescue missions, firefighting operations, and even VIP transportation.

Enhancing Functional Performance





To enhance operational effectiveness, numerous actions are implemented in the UH-60 helicopter. The UH-60 helicopter is equipped with advanced navigation, interaction, and objective systems, permitting for boosted situational understanding and effective coordination in between crew participants.


In enhancement to innovative avionics, the UH-60 helicopter includes effective engine modern technology. Making use of twin General Electric T700-GE-701C engines offers adequate power while decreasing fuel usage. This not only reduces functional prices yet also extends the variety and endurance of the aircraft. In addition, the UH-60 helicopter includes a robust maintenance program. Normal assessments and set up upkeep guarantee that the aircraft remains in optimal condition, reducing downtime and taking full advantage of availability for goals.

Streamlining Maintenance Processes



uh 60uh 60
In order to additional enhance operational effectiveness, the UH-60 helicopter concentrates on streamlining maintenance procedures. This is crucial in ensuring that the airplane continues to read be in peak problem and is always prepared for release. By simplifying upkeep processes, the UH-60 helicopter aims to minimize downtime and enhance its availability for missions.


One method the UH-60 helicopter attains this is via the execution of a computerized maintenance administration system (CMMS) This system permits efficient tracking and scheduling of maintenance tasks, guaranteeing that upkeep is performed promptly and in an organized fashion. It additionally aids in managing extra parts stock, reducing the time needed for procurement and lessening the danger of stockouts.


Additionally, the UH-60 helicopter employs a condition-based maintenance (CBM) method. This indicates that maintenance actions are executed based on the real condition of the aircraft, as opposed to on a dealt with timetable. By making use of sensing units and data analysis, the UH-60 helicopter can find possible concerns before they end up being vital, permitting for proactive upkeep and minimizing the danger of unforeseen failures.


In Addition, the UH-60 helicopter integrates a modular design, which streamlines upkeep and decreases turn-around time. The aircraft's parts are designed to be conveniently available and replaceable, decreasing the requirement for considerable disassembly and decreasing upkeep hours.
